Banarasi Hand Painted Saree

Image
A Banarasi hand painted saree is where heritage meets artistic expression. Crafted on rich Banarasi fabric and adorned with intricate hand painting, this saree reflects timeless Indian craftsmanship. Each brushstroke is done by skilled artisans, making every piece truly one of a kind. The luxurious texture of Banarasi silk provides the perfect canvas for hand-painted motifs inspired by nature, mythology, and traditional Indian art. Ideal for weddings, festive celebrations, and cultural gatherings, this saree adds elegance without being overwhelming. Pair it with classic jewelry to highlight its artistic beauty. Mushroo Silk Hand Painted Saree: A Canvas of Craft and Culture

Image
The Mushroo silk hand painted saree brings together the richness of traditional weaving and the individuality of hand artistry. Mushroo silk is known for its smooth texture and subtle sheen, making it a beautiful base for hand painting. Each saree becomes a wearable canvas where colors and motifs come alive through careful brushwork, ensuring that no two pieces are ever exactly the same. What makes a hand painted Mushroo silk saree special is the time and intention behind it. Artisans paint directly onto the fabric, allowing the design to flow naturally with the weave. Floral patterns, abstract forms, or inspired elements from nature often find their way onto the saree, creating a balanced blend of heritage and contemporary expression. The softness of Mushroo silk also allows the colors to settle beautifully, giving depth and character to the artwork.
